Facts

  • Rates of poly-drug use are higher among full-time college students who have used Adderall non-medically in the past year than among those who have not used the drug non-medically.
  • Psychotic symptoms that are consistent with methamphetamine may linger for months or years after someone who has been addicted to the drug stops using it.
  • Over-the-counter stimulants are often sold as "speed" or other amphetamines, and many deaths due to stroke have been reported following massive doses of look-alike combinations.
  • Major heroin withdrawal symptoms peek about 48 and 72 hours after the last heroin dose and subside after about a week.

Struggling with any form of drug addiction is a serious burden to carry, and one which comes with numerous consequences if left unresolved. People with the very best of intentions who want to quit generally try and do so many times over with no success, and wind up just dropping deeper into a life of addiction. There are causes why people cannot quit on their own, and these causes are what make drug treatment in Richfield a more successful and verified method of handling drug addiction.

The positive aspects of a drug rehab in Richfield involve having the support and tools at hand to resolve any difficulties and challenges that may come up in the course of detox and withdrawal, as well as the option to address the real problems that triggered drug addiction which are typically not physical ones at all. For example, many individuals become involved in substance abuse to mask and avoid serious problems in their lives. If one only makes an attempt to overcome the physical urges and such on one's own, they really aren't making any headway at really resolving the psychological and emotional issues, that once resolved, will assure long-term sobriety.

Once a particular person comes to terms with the fact that they need help to resolve drug addiction, the next action is selecting the appropriate drug rehab for them. Some drug rehab programs don't require any type of inpatient stay and supply services on an outpatient basis for instance. At this kind of drug rehab the individual receives treatment during the day and returns home in the evening. While this type of drug rehab may seem convenient, it will not offer the appropriate treatment environment for a person who desires to step away from drug influences and other conditions which could compromise one's sobriety. The most verified and successful treatment settings are those which involve an inpatient or residential stay, so that the person can focus entirely on bettering themselves and healing from addiction, not on every day interruptions and drug addiction triggers.

For instance, someone or some situation in one's environment could be the actual cause of one's drug use. If the person returns to this just about every day while in drug rehab, all gains will be lost and most will usually relapse. There are also varying lengths of stay even in inpatient and residential drug rehabilitation programs, with treatment curriculums varying from 30 days to up to a year for some. As a rule of thumb, someone who is intent on resolving addiction issues once and for all should remain in drug rehab as long as it requires. A month in treatment is rarely enough time to even recuperate physically from continual substance abuse. A significant amount of time is needed, even months in some instances, to benefit from intensive therapy and other treatment tools to heal mentally and emotionally so that one can genuinely make a clean start once treatment is finished.
